Why Minimalist Prints Are Gaining Popularity
The surge in demand for trending minimalist wall art can be traced to several factors. First, minimalist designs are highly adaptable—they work with nearly any color scheme or decor style, from Scandinavian to modern farmhouse. Their understated elegance makes them a safe yet stylish choice for both renters and homeowners who want to refresh their spaces without overwhelming the room.
Another reason for their popularity is the growing focus on wellness and mental clarity. Minimalist art, with its uncluttered forms and soothing tones, contributes to a serene atmosphere, which is especially valued in today’s fast-paced world. It’s no surprise that many people are choosing these prints for bedrooms, meditation corners, and home offices to foster a sense of calm and focus.

How to Choose the Right Minimalist Prints for Your Space
Selecting the perfect minimalist artwork involves considering both your personal taste and the specific needs of your room. Here are a few practical tips to guide your decision:
- Match the mood: Think about the atmosphere you want to create. For a calming effect, opt for soft colors and organic forms. For a more dynamic look, geometric or abstract prints may be ideal.
- Consider scale: Large prints can serve as a focal point, while smaller pieces work well in groups or as part of a gallery wall.
- Coordinate with your decor: Minimalist art is versatile, but it’s still important to ensure that the colors and style complement your existing furnishings and wall color.

Displaying Minimalist Art: Layout and Arrangement Tips
How you display your prints can be just as important as the artwork you choose. Here are some strategies to maximize the impact of your minimalist pieces:
- Single statement piece: Hang one large print above a sofa, bed, or console for a bold yet understated effect.
- Symmetrical arrangements: Use pairs or sets of prints in a grid or linear layout for a clean, organized look.

Incorporating Minimalist Art into Different Rooms
Minimalist prints are incredibly versatile and can enhance nearly any room in the home. Here’s how to make the most of them in various spaces:
- Living room: Use a large abstract piece as a focal point, or create a gallery wall above the sofa for visual interest.
- Bedroom: Choose calming, soft-toned prints for above the bed or on a feature wall to promote relaxation.
- Home office: Select geometric or line art prints to inspire focus and creativity without adding visual clutter.
- Entryway: Welcome guests with a simple, elegant piece that sets the tone for your home’s style.
- Dining area: Opt for subtle color washes or organic shapes that complement your tableware and furnishings.
